Word Explorer

Turbosupercharger

A turbocharger, an exhaust-powered turbine used to power increased air intake to an internal combustion engine ; an exhaust-turbine powered (in place of engine-powered) supercharger.

📖 Definitions of "Turbosupercharger"

noun
  1. 1

    A turbocharger, an exhaust-powered turbine used to power increased air intake to an internal combustion engine ; an exhaust-turbine powered (in place of engine-powered) supercharger.

  2. 2

    A twincharger, combination of a supercharger and a turbocharger.

Translate “Turbosupercharger” into Another Language

Pick a language — the word will be pre-filled in the translator.

Home/Dictionary/Turbosupercharger